Post by 77oneton on Feb 12, 2008 21:19:25 GMT -5
just started weight reduction. removed the tool box, the 65 gal tank, the bed, the grill, the fenders, the hood, and started removing unnecessary parts. not to mention the exo came off awhile ago. it's gotta be at least 1200-1500lbs lighter than last years SB3. the truck looks naked now. i'll post pics later

Post by 77oneton on Mar 24, 2008 18:37:38 GMT -5
havn't hadmuch computer time at home so the pics are coming.
i just decided to narrow the bed, and put it back on, so that is done and looks pretty good. now i will do the same for the front. the gears have been swapped, now 5.38. the high pinion 60 is almost complete, still need drive flanges. i just put new yukon chromoly axles and superjoints in and can't wait to try them out. getting closer to complete, just the nickle and dime things now that are killing me.
